Official Rules for LPIN 2018 Awards

Herein stated are the Official Rules for LPIN Awards voter registration and casting ballots for Award Year 2018.

I. a) Three elected awards will be presented for 2018 which covers the period January 1, 2018 through December 31, 2018.

b) Courtesan of the Year (COY) - Working Girls must have been active in LPIN during a portion of the calendar year 2018 to be eligible for Courtesan of the Year nomination.  If a Lady has previously won COY, she is ineligible regardless of her working name.

c) Brothel of the Year (BOY) and Rural Brothel of the Year (RBOY) - Brothels must have been in operation during a portion of the calendar year 2018 to be eligible for Brothel of the Year or Rural Brothel of the Year nominations. 

d) The Brothel of the Year and Rural Brothel of the Year classifications will be based on a 50 mile radius from Main and Fremont Streets in Las Vegas, and 1st and Virginia Streets in Reno.  All brothels located within 50 miles of one of these locations (straight-line measurement) will be in the Brothel of the Year category.  All others will be in the Rural Brothel of the Year category.

II. a) Voter Registration opened at the Annual Reno Meeting and closes midnight December 31, 2018 PST.   

b) The Nominating Round begins February 1, 2019 and ends midnight February 28, 2019 PST.

c) The Preliminary Voting Round begins March 4, 2019 and ends midnight March 31, 2019 PDT.

d) The Final Voting Round begins April 4, 2019 and ends midnight April 30, 2019 PDT.

III. a) It is hereby stipulated that Courtesan clients or actual brothel patrons that visit brothels and party be the persons to cast ballots in the nominating and voting rounds.  Therefore, Courtesans, brothel management and employees shall be precluded from registering to vote and casting ballots in LPIN Awards contests.   

b) LPIN Awards voter registrants must provide LPIN Awards Registered Voter or LPIN Awards Committee member references that have met them in person.  Prospective voter registrants who desire to be added to the Official LPIN 2018 Awards Registered Voters List must submit a Voter Registration Form during the voter registration period.  They must provide their handle, email address, and the handles of LPIN Awards Registered Voters that have met them in person.   Voter registrants who haven't met any LPIN Awards registered voters must list all the LPIN Courtesans and others in our community that have met them in person for committee evaluation and confirmation.   

c) Voter Registrants' references must verify that they have met the prospective registrant in person before they will be added to the Official LPIN 2018 Awards Registered Voters List subject to LPIN Awards Committee confirmation.

IV. a) LPIN Awards registered voters who still meet the registration requirements do not need to register again.  It's recommended LPIN Awards registered voters check the Official Registered Voters List for LPIN 2018 Awards to make certain their voter handle is still registered.     

b) Voters whose handles have been removed from the LPIN Awards Registered Voters List must reregister during the voter registration period.  Voters that fail to cast a ballot in the last two LPIN contests will be removed from the following year's Registered Voters List.     

c) A Registered Voter email address change may be requested by sending a PM to the LPIN Awards Committee or email to vote@lpinawards.com.  Voters must include their handle, old email address, new email address, and the committee will process the change.  Alternatively, registered voters may reregister during the voter registration period.   

V. a) Voters must enter their handle and voter registration or LPIN Awards board email address when casting ballots for their selected candidates.  Therefore, it's imperative to record the precise handle and email address submitted for registration purposes, since it must be provided in nominating and voting rounds.  The LPIN Awards Committee will not be able to provide voters their registration information, since it's the voters' responsibility to retain it.  Voters who can't remember their registration information must reregister during the next registration period. 

b) Registered Voters will be allowed to submit only one nomination or one vote in each round of the contest for each of the three categories.  Each person is allowed only one ballot in each of the three contest rounds.  A voter will not be allowed to change their vote once it has been submitted and accepted.  Only the first valid ballot in a given round will be accepted by that handle with follow-up ballots being ignored.

c) Any nomination or vote submitted without the registered voter handle and email address will be declared invalid.  Those voters will not be contacted, and their ballot will not count.  However, a ballot rejection notation will be posted on the list of voters who participated in that round of the contest.  It is imperative that voters check the list of voters that participated in each round of the contest to confirm that their ballots were received, accepted and counted.

VI. a) Individuals circumventing the rules (using multiple or duplicate handles to vote or otherwise illegitimately casting ballots) shall be immediately stricken from the Registered Voters List. Their ballots shall be disqualified, and henceforth they shall be prohibited from participating in LPIN Awards contests.

VII. a) The top five candidates in each category from the Preliminary Voting Round will proceed to the Final Voting Round.  However, BOY category finalists will be limited to 50% of the total eligible candidates.

b) In case of a tie for fifth place in any category at the end of the Preliminary Voting Round, the tie will be broken in favor of the candidate receiving the earliest vote involved in the tie according to the date and time stamped ballot.

c) In case of a tie for first place in the BOY or RBOY categories at the end of the Final Voting Round, the tie will be broken in favor of the candidate receiving the earliest vote involved in the tie according to the date and time stamped ballot.

d) COY, BOY & RBOY Winners will be honored at the LPIN Awards Banquet to be held on Friday July 19, 2019 from 5 PM to 8 PM. 

VIII. a) There shall be absolutely NO PHOTOGRAPHY allowed inside the banquet hall except by the official photographers Sheri and Dtech.  Violators will be banned from participation in future LPIN Awards contests and banquets. 

IX. a) The LPIN Awards Committee will address unforeseen circumstances that arise and provide a resolution by majority vote of the LPIN Awards Committee.

History of the LPIN Awards

In 2017, the Awards Committee conducted nominations in February, voting in March through April and selected awards for 2016 Courtesan of the Year, Brothel of the Year, and Rural brothel of the Year.  The committee consisted of firefighter, highdrive, Lecher, Little Richard, Mikey, and MrTShirt.  Mikey hosted his second Annual Awards Banquet.  All fifteen finalists, Alice Little, Coco, Kitti Minx, Rachel Varga, Victoria, Chicken Ranch, Love Ranch, Mustang Ranch, Sagebrush Ranch, Sheri's Ranch, Alien Cathouse, Desert Club, Dovetail Ranch, Inez's D&D and Mona's Ranch, were presented framed certificates, and the three winners, Rachel Varga, Mustang Ranch and Dovetail Ranch, were presented framed certificates plus Crystal Art Duet Flame Awards.  Rachel Varga of Mustang Ranch won Courtesan of the Year on her first nomination and first year in LPIN, Mustang Ranch won their fourth consecutive Brothel of the Year, and the Dovetail Ranch won their fifth Rural Brothel of the Year.  Rachel Varga and Madam Tara attended and accepted the COY and BOY awards respectively.  Lee delivered and presented the RBOY Award to Madam Monica at the Dovetail Ranch on Saturday following the Awards Banquet.  Mikey held a Hawaiian shirt contest and Dtech was the winner; Jade Capri donated the $50 prize and Dtech very generously donated it back to the awards committee fund.

The cwmcawards.com website was permanently shutdown on August 15, 2017 in preparation for termination.  Subsequently, the Awards Committee registered two domains and constructed two websites.  CWMC Awards, cwmcawards.net, was established to preserve the history of the awards.  LPIN Awards, lpinawards.com, was established to continue the awards contests.  The Awards Committee had permanently separated from SIN, so the decision was made to coordinate the awards contests under LPIN Awards.  There were multiple legitimate reasons for this decision.  LPIN Awards does not have an affiliation or relationship with any other organization, but CWMC Awards had a historic connection to SIN which the awards committee felt must be severed.  Also, the CWMC acronym carried an unsavory connotation that LPIN Awards does not possess.  LPIN Awards better defines the awards, and may be more socially acceptable while not being offensive to Courtesans.  LPIN Awards is totally separate and independent; therefore, registered voters are not required to be members of any other message board.  All LPIN Courtesans who worked during the award year (except previous winners) or Brothels that operated during the period would be eligible candidates.

The LPIN Awards Committee would like to acknowledge and thank Courtesan of the Year Rachel Varga for donating an exceptionally generous gift of professional web developer custom services to configure the LPIN Awards websites to awards committee specifications.  The Awards Committee would not have been able to administer a first-rate contest without Rachel Varga's contribution, and may not have been able to coordinate a 2017 contest period.  The LPIN Community owes Rachel a great debt of gratitude for her benevolence and generosity. 

In 2018, the LPIN 2017 Awards contest was coordinated with the Nomination Round in February 2018, the Preliminary Voting Round in March 2018, the Final Voting Round in April 2018, and the awards were presented at the LPIN Awards Banquet on July 20, 2018.  The LPIN Awards Committee conducted voting and selected awards for Courtesan of the Year, Brothel of the Year, and Rural Brothel of the Year.  The Official LPIN 2017 Awards Registered Voters List increased by 29 voters due largely to the fact that LPIN Awards is totally independent and not affiliated with any message board.  The committee consisted of firefighter, FumbleNutts, highdrive, Little Richard, Mikey and MrTShirt.  Mikey hosted the Annual Banquet for the third straight year, and it was promoted as the LPIN Awards Banquet to avoid confusion due to the proposed organization of a competitive awards contest.  All fifteen finalists, Lexie James, Roxy, Roxy Gold, Vanity Affair, Victoria, Chicken Ranch, Love Ranch, Mustang Ranch, Sagebrush Ranch, Sheri's Ranch, Desert Club, Dovetail Ranch, Inez's D&D, Love Ranch South and Mona's Ranch, were presented framed finalist certificates, and the three winners, Roxy, Mustang Ranch and Dovetail Ranch, were presented framed winner certificates plus Crystal Art Triad Flame Awards.   

Roxy of Dovetail Ranch won LPIN 2017 Awards Courtesan of the Year on her first nomination, Mustang Ranch won their fifth consecutive Brothel of the Year, and Dovetail Ranch won their sixth Rural Brothel of the Year award.  Roxy, Madam Monica, Madam Tara and Madam Jennifer attended and accepted the COY, RBOY and BOY awards respectively.  Interested bystander and Rachel Varga were presented Certificates of Appreciation for their assistance to ensure the continuation of the awards contests.  In addition, Rachel Varga was presented a Crystal Art Triad Flame 2016 Courtesan of the Year Award, since it was appropriate that she receive the first LPIN Award due to her support of the awards contests and generous gift of professional web developer services.  Rachel Varga's BrothelLife was recognized as the Best Independent Forum.  Goldie was presented a Most Respected Hoserette Certificate.  Mikey held a Hawaiian shirt contest and Dtech was the winner for the second straight year. 

In 2019, the LPIN 2018 Awards contest was coordinated with the Nomination Round in February 2019, the Preliminary Voting Round in March 2019, the Final Voting Round in April 2019, and the certificates and awards were presented at the LPIN Awards Banquet on July 19, 2019.  The LPIN Awards Committee conducted voting and selected awards for Courtesan of the Year, Brothel of the Year, and Rural Brothel of the Year.  The LPIN Awards Committee consisted of firefighter, FumbleNutts, highdrive, Little Richard, Mikey and MrTShirt.  Little Richard is the awards team's senior member and advisor, and this marked Little Richard's 12th consecutive year serving on the awards committee.  Mikey hosted the Annual LPIN Awards Banquet for the fourth straight year.  All fourteen finalists, Dahlia, Lily, Roxy Gold, Vanity Affair, Victoria, Chicken Ranch, Mustang Ranch, Sagebrush Ranch, Sheri's Ranch, Alien Cathouse, Dovetail Ranch, Inez's D&D, Love Ranch South and Mona's Ranch, were presented framed finalist certificates, and the four winners, Roxy Gold, Victoria, Mustang Ranch and Dovetail Ranch, were presented framed winner certificates plus Crystal Art Triad Flame Awards.

Roxy Gold of Sagebrush Ranch and Victoria of Mustang Ranch won LPIN 2018 Awards Courtesan of the Year, Mustang Ranch won their sixth consecutive Brothel of the Year, and Dovetail Ranch won their seventh Rural Brothel of the Year.  Roxy Gold & Victoria, Roxy, Jameson & Belle, and Madam Tara & Madam Jennifer attended and accepted the COY, RBOY and BOY awards respectively.  Sheri was presented a Certificate of Appreciation for continued support of the awards contests, COY Sash & Tiara assistance, and co-hosting the Annual Picnic.  Mikey was presented a Certificate of Appreciation for continued support of the awards contests, four consecutive time banquet host, active committee member, and vote counter.  Little Richard was presented a 12 Year Service Commendation for continuous awards committee assistance as an active committee member, advisor, and vote counter.  In addition, Rachel Varga was presented a Crystal Art Triad Flame "Major Contributor" Award for her generous donation of professional web developer services and extensive technical assistance throughout LPIN Awards two year existence.

In 2020, the LPIN 2019 Awards contest was coordinated with the Nomination Round in February 2020, the Preliminary Voting Round in March 2020, the Final Voting Round in April 2020, and the certificates and awards were presented at Interested bystander and Sheri's Picnic on July 18, 2020 where 18 people attended.  The LPIN Awards Committee conducted voting and selected awards for Courtesan of the Year, Brothel of the Year, and Rural Brothel of the Year.  The LPIN Awards Committee consisted of 1Bytetoomany, firefighter, FumbleNutts, highdrive, Lee, Little Richard, Mikey and MrTShirt.  Firefighter, Little Richard and MrTShirt planned to host the Annual LPIN Awards Banquet but it was cancelled by the venue due to gathering restrictions; therefore, LPIN 2019 Awards were presented at Interested bystander and Sheri's Picnic.  All fourteen finalists, CiCi, Dahlia, Lena Starr, Tori, Vanity Affair, Chicken Ranch, Mustang Ranch, Sagebrush Ranch, Sheri's Ranch, Alien Cathouse, Dovetail Ranch, Inez's D&D, Mona's Ranch and Sue's Fantasy Club, were presented framed finalist certificates, and the three winners, Vanity Affair, Mustang Ranch and Dovetail Ranch, were presented framed winner certificates plus Crystal Art Triad Flame Awards.

Vanity Affair of Dovetail Ranch won LPIN 2019 Awards Courtesan of the Year, Mustang Ranch won their seventh consecutive Brothel of the Year, and Dovetail Ranch won their eighth Rural Brothel of the Year.  Vanity Affair accepted the Courtesan of the Year Award with tears in her eyes.  Jagged accepted the Brothel of the Year Award for Mustang Ranch.  Lee accepted the Rural Brothel of the Year Award for Dovetail Ranch.  Special Appreciation Certificates were presented to Bashful who is the CWMC founder, DJ Jorge who edited LPIN Awards HTML ballots enabling the contests to be continued, dtech for professional photographer services, Jagged for his colorful Jagged Awards, and Just Tom & Shovel for providing their barbecuing talents at the Annual Picnics.

In 2021, the LPIN 2020 Awards contest was coordinated with the Nomination Round in February 2021, the Preliminary Voting Round in March 2021, the Final Voting Round in April 2021, and the certificates and awards were presented at LPIN Awards Banquet MMXXI on July 16, 2021 where 60 people attended.  The LPIN Awards Committee conducted voting and selected Crystal Art Awards for All Time Favorite Courtesan of the Year, Courtesan of the Year, Brothel of the Year, and Rural Brothel of the Year.  The LPIN Awards Committee consisted of 1Bytetoomany, DJ Jorge, firefighter, FumbleNutts, Lee, Little Richard and MrTShirt.  Firefighter, Little Richard and MrTShirt hosted the Annual LPIN Awards Presentations for the second straight year.  All nineteen finalists, Lexy, Rachel Varga, Roxy, Roxy Gold, Shanice, Bailey Paige, Chelsea London, Dahlia, Dennae, Morgan, Chicken Ranch, Mustang Ranch, Sagebrush Ranch, Sheri's Ranch, Alien Cathouse, Desert Club, Dovetail Ranch, Inez's D&D and Mona's Ranch, were presented framed finalist certificates, and the four winners, Rachel Varga, Dahlia, Mustang Ranch and Dovetail Ranch, were presented framed winner certificates plus Crystal Art Triad Flame Awards.

Rachel Varga of Mustang Ranch won All Time Favorite Courtesan of the Year, Dahlia of Chicken Ranch won LPIN 2020 Awards Courtesan of the Year, Mustang Ranch won their eighth consecutive Brothel of the Year, and Dovetail Ranch won their ninth Rural Brothel of the Year.  Rachel Varga accepted the All Time Favorite Courtesan of the Year award.  Dahlia accepted the Courtesan of the Year Award.  Madam Tara accepted the Brothel of the Year Award for Mustang Ranch.  Madam Monica accepted the Rural Brothel of the Year Award for Dovetail Ranch.  A Special Appreciation Certificate was presented to Logcabin who served on the awards committee, and provided assistance at the Annual Banquet for many years.  The awards committee would like to thank Rachel Varga and Funmonger for their generous banquet donations.  A Special 14 Year Service Commendation was presented to Little Richard who is the senior active participating awards committee member, advisor, vote counter, and 2012, 2013 & 2021 banquet host.

In 2022, the LPIN 2021 Awards contest was coordinated with the Nomination Round in February 2022, the Preliminary Voting Round in March 2022, the Final Voting Round in April 2022, and the certificates and awards were presented at LPIN Awards Banquet MMXXII on July 15, 2022 where 50 people attended.  The LPIN Awards Committee conducted voting and selected Crystal Art Awards for Courtesan of the Year, Brothel of the Year, and Rural Brothel of the Year.  The LPIN Awards Committee consisted of 1Bytetoomany, firefighter, Lee, MrTShirt and Committee Advisor Little Richard.  Firefighter, Little Richard and MrTShirt hosted the Annual LPIN Awards Presentations for the third straight year.  All fourteen finalists, Dennae, Luna, Max-A-Million, Mila Tommy, Morgan, Chicken Ranch, Mustang Ranch, Sagebrush Ranch, Sheri's Ranch, Alien Cathouse, Desert Club, Dovetail Ranch, Mona's Ranch and Sue's Fantasy Club, were presented framed finalist certificates, and the three winners, Mila Tommy, Mustang Ranch and Mona's Ranch. were presented framed winner certificates plus Crystal Art Triad Flame Awards.

First time finalist Mila Tommy of Mona's Ranch won LPIN 2021 Awards Courtesan of the Year, Mustang Ranch won their ninth consecutive Brothel of the Year, and Mona's Ranch won their first Rural Brothel of the Year.  Mila Tommy accepted the Courtesan of the Year Award.  Madam Tara and Amber accepted the Brothel of the Year Award for Mustang Ranch.  Louis, Peter and Anna accepted the Rural Brothel of the Year Award for Mona's Ranch.  Lee was presented a Certificate of Appreciation for awards committee service and benefactor support.  MrTShirt was presented a Certificate of Appreciation for awards committee service, benefactor support and hosting awards banquets.  Rachel Varga and Funmonger were presented Certificates of Appreciation for their generous donations and continued support.  Saphire Rae was honored as Outstanding Courtesan, and a Special Certificate was presented to Mona's Ranch on behalf of Saphire Rae.  Lance Gilman, Jennifer Barnes, Tara Adkins & Mustang Ranch were presented an Appreciation Award and framed certificates for continued support of the awards contests, awards banquets, and our client group.  A Special Award and framed certificate were presented to Rachel Varga who was recognized and honored as Firefighter's All Time Favorite Courtesan.   

In 2023, the LPIN 2022 Awards contest was coordinated with the Nomination Round in March 2023, the Preliminary Voting Round in April 2023, the Final Voting Round in May 2023, and certificates and awards were presented at Elko Awards Banquet on Wednesday July 19, 2023 where 61 people attended.  Cookie Monster hosted the Awards Banquet for the first time in Elko, paid for three Crystal Art Awards, and refunded attendees' banquet reservation payments upon arrival at the banquet.  The LPIN Awards Committee consisted of Armond, Chicago Bob, firefighter, Lee, MrTShirt and Committee Advisor Little Richard.  The LPIN Awards Committee conducted voting and selected Crystal Art Awards for Courtesan of the Year, Brothel of the Year, Rural Brothel of the Year, and Hall of Fame.  All 19 LPIN 2022 Awards Finalists, Alien Cathouse, Desert Club, Dovetail Ranch, Inez's D&D, Mona's Ranch, Chicken Ranch, Mustang Ranch, Sagebrush Ranch, Sheri's Ranch, Ayana, Chelsea London, Jessy, Madame Mama Mia, Rebecca Brite, Lexy, Mila Tommy, Rachel Varga, Saphire Rae, and Madam Sonja were presented framed Finalist, Winner or Inductee certificates.  The Hall of Fame Inductees were presented framed Inductee certificates plus Crystal Art Flame Awards.  The COY, BOY and RBOY Winners were presented framed winner certificates plus Crystal Art Flame Awards.

First time finalists Jessy (Mona's Ranch) and Madame Mama Mia (Stardust Ranch) won LPIN 2022 Awards Courtesan of the Year.  COY finalists Ayana (Mustang Ranch) and Chelsea London (Mustang Ranch) attended the awards presentations banquet; unfortunately, Jessy, Madame Mama Mia and Rebecca Brite (Sagebrush Ranch) were unable to attend.  Armond presented finalist certificates to Ayana and Chelsea London.   
Mustang Ranch won their tenth consecutive Brothel of the Year.  Mustang Ranch was the only BOY finalist in attendance.  Chicken Ranch, Sagebrush Ranch and Sheri's Ranch were absent.  Madam Tara and Rachel Varga accepted the Brothel of the Year Award for Mustang Ranch from Chicago Bob.
Mona's Ranch won their second straight Rural Brothel of the Year.  MrTShirt announced the RBOY finalists and requested they come forward to the podium.  RBOY finalists Desert Club, Dovetail Ranch, Inez's D&D and Mona's Ranch attended the awards banquet: however, Alien Cathouse was absent.  Peter and Anna accepted the Rural Brothel of the Year Award for Mona's Ranch from Cookie Monster.   
Lexy (Chicken Ranch), Mila Tommy (Mona's Ranch), Rachel Varga (Mustang Ranch), Saphire Rae (Mona's Ranch) and Madam Sonja (Love Ranch Vegas) were the first five Inductees in the LPIN Hall of Fame.  Rachel Varga was the first Courtesan Inducted into the Hall of Fame, since she received the most votes in the contest.  Rachel Varga and Mila Tommy accepted their Hall of Fame Awards from firefighter.  Anna accepted Saphire Rae's Hall of Fame Award.  Lexy and Sonja were unable to attend the banquet.

In 2024, the LPIN 2023 Awards contest was coordinated with the Nominating Round in April 2024, the Preliminary Voting Round in April 2024, the Final Voting Round in May 2024, and certificates and awards were presented at the Reno Awards Banquet on Friday July 19, 2024 where 50 people attended.  The LPIN Awards committee hosted the Awards Banquet and benefactor MIG949 generously donated for the purchase of six Crystal Art USA Awards.  The LPIN 2023 Awards Committee consisted of Armond, firefighter, Lee, MIG949, MrTShirt and Committee Advisor Little Richard.  The LPIN Awards Committee conducted voting and selected Crystal Art USA Awards for Courtesan of the Year, Rookie Courtesan of the Year, Brothel of the Year, Rural Brothel of the Year, and Hall of Fame.  All 24 LPIN 2023 Awards Finalists, Desert Club, Desert Rose, Dovetail Ranch, Inez's D&D, Mona's Ranch, Chicken Ranch, Mustang Ranch, Sagebrush Ranch, Sheri's Ranch, Ember Solaris, Leila, Riley Gates, Vivian, Wednesday, Leah, Riley Gates, Rose, Samantha, Vera Bliss, Dahlia, Madam Jennifer, Madam Tara, Roxy, and Vanity Affair were presented Finalist or framed Winner certificates.  The COY, RCOY, BOY, RBOY Winners and HOF Inductees were presented framed Winner or Inductee certificates plus Crystal Art USA Awards.
